2001 JAN 24 - (NewsRx.com & NewsRx.net) -- BioPulse International, Inc., (BIOP), San Ysidro, California, announced the development of multiple Tumor-Specific Cancer Vaccines (TSV).
The vaccines are based on the company's dendritic cell cancer vaccine technology. These vaccines will potentially offer additional alternatives to cancer patients.
Cancer vaccines that have been under investigation by BioPulse previously used only patient-specific tumor antigens. This approach provides a customized and specific vaccine product for each patient. The new tumor-specific vaccines use a combination of tumor antigens designed to target a class of tumors. This strategy potentially allows for a single vaccine to be useful to a variety of patients that share a common tumor type.
